Detailed Engineering Specifications

Purpose-built for heavy-duty applications, this U-bolt features a 3.51-inch inside width (A) and a 3.08-inch inside length (B), perfectly accommodating 3-inch nominal pipe. Constructed from high-grade brass, it exhibits superior resistance to galvanic corrosion, making it an optimal choice for marine, chemical processing, and other aggressive environments. The 1/2"-13 UNC threads provide robust mechanical fastening capabilities, ensuring secure attachment to mounting surfaces for continuous, vibration-resistant support.

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Over-tightening the nuts, which can deform the pipe or mounting surface.Tighten nuts firmly but avoid excessive force; use a torque wrench if precise specifications are required.
Using the wrong size U-bolt for the pipe diameter, leading to a loose or overly constrained fit.Verify the U-bolt's inside dimensions (width and length) against the nominal pipe size and any associated insulation or cladding.
